According to the American Kennel Club ( AKC ), training your dog to drop something in his mouth centers on trading one item for another. Start by giving your dog a toy he likes but doesn’t love, and then offer him his favorite toy or a treat in exchange.

Splet20. okt. 2024 · Step 1: Charge the Clicker. If your dog has never used a clicker before, or if they haven’t used it in a while, start by “charging” the clicker. Charging a clicker isn’t complicated, simply click then treat your dog. The click will start to get their attention. You will know that the clicker is “charged” when the sound of the click ... SpletStep 1: Get a good toy container. First, you need to have a central place for keeping his toys. A good toy container would be the most ideal place to keep all your dog’s toys. Get a toy container that has a mouth that is wide enough to enable your dog easily drop the toys.
